New white and blue-dial editions bring fresh style to the Nautique GMT
Vulcain has, in recent years, been steadily expanding its horizons. Alongside chronographs, divers, and three-hand classics, the brand has found renewed identity by revisiting its vintage archives. The Skindiver Nautique line, inspired by a 1960s diver, has become a cornerstone of this revival, and it now welcomes two new editions to the Skindiver Nautique GMT collection with white and blue dials.
The watch is crafted from vertically brushed 316L stainless steel, with compact proportions of 38.3 mm in diameter and 12.2 mm in thickness. Framing the case is a bi-directional ceramic bezel engraved with a 24-hour scale for quick reading of a second time zone. A double-domed sapphire crystal with anti-reflective treatment completes the design. The blue-dial limited edition features a sapphire exhibition back that reveals the movement, while the white-dial version opts for a polished screw-down steel back. Water resistance is rated at 200 meters.

The matte white dial is paired with beige Super-LumiNova hands and indices, contrasted by a striking red GMT hand for quick legibility. The matte blue dial features white lume and a turquoise-tipped GMT hand. A date window is positioned at 3 o’clock.
Powering the watch is the Soprod C125 GMT, an automatic movement operating at 28,800 vph (4 Hz) with a 42-hour power reserve. The caliber also allows independent adjustment of the 24-hour hand.

The blue edition is fitted with a matching blue rubber strap, while the white-dial reference is offered on a black rubber strap or a stainless steel bracelet. The bracelet is equipped with a micro-adjustable clasp for enhanced comfort.
![]() | ![]() |
The blue-dial version is limited to 100 pieces and priced at USD 2,170 / AED 8,750, while the white-dial version joins the brand’s permanent collection, priced at USD 2,080 / AED 8,350 on rubber and USD 2,370 / AED 9,450 on a steel bracelet.
